Background
A large amount of blast furnace gas is generated in the smelting process of a blast furnace, after dust removal and purification and residual pressure power generation, the clean blast furnace gas flows into a gas main pipe and a hot blast furnace system along pipelines, and when the blast furnace is overhauled, a U-shaped pipe is usually adopted between a blast furnace gas treatment system and the main pipe gas system for water sealing, so that the two parts can be quickly and effectively separated for overhauling. However, the water sealing technology has the defects that the diameter of the blast furnace gas pipeline is large, a common water supply pipeline is adopted to fill water into the U-shaped gas pipe, the water filling time is long, when water is filled into the gas pipeline, the pressure inside the gas pipeline is large, the water sealing is easy to be punctured by the blast furnace gas, the overflowing gas is directly discharged to the peripheral air, the peripheral air pollution is caused, and the health of peripheral residents is easily threatened.

The utility model has the advantages that:
1. the device of processing gas pipeline water seal of this design has adopted the mode of intaking in grades when handling gas pipeline water seal, can effectively avoid taking place because of the too big condition that leads to the puncture of the inside atmospheric pressure of gas pipeline, has greatly improved the security of equipment, and first water tank is inside to be equipped with two hydroeciums, through the valve of control bottom three-way pipe for can supply water to the second water tank in succession, accelerate the water seal speed, improve work efficiency.
2. The device of the processing gas pipeline water seal of this design, when carrying out the water seal and handling, consider because gas pipeline internal pressure is too big, it spills over to have the gas when carrying out the water seal, in order to avoid the gas to spill over the polluted air, the gas collecting cylinder of special gas collection is equipped with in second water tank inside, can save inside the gas collecting cylinder when the gas spills over, and cold water still can flow into the drain pipe inside because of extruded effect, can not influence follow-up water seal, after the water seal finishes, open the top cap at second water tank top, can handle the gas of collecting, avoid causing the atmosphere pollution.

The working principle is as follows: when the device for treating the water seal of the gas pipeline is used, firstly, the air in the first water tank 1 is discharged and then cold water is injected into the first water tank 1, then a valve at the bottom of the three-way pipe 9 is opened, the first electric hydraulic rod 6 is started to press the cold water in the first water chamber 2 into the second water tank 10, then the cold water is pressed into the water discharge pipe 14, at the moment, the water discharge control valve 16 is opened, the cold water can flow into the gas U-shaped pipe 15, the gas in the gas pipeline 17 can overflow and be collected in the gas collecting cylinder 13, after the water seal treatment is finished, the water discharge control valve 16 is closed, the top cover 11 at the top of the second water tank 10 is opened, and the gas in the gas collecting cylinder 13 is.
